Boston, MA — “Honey Bunny (the Hip-Hop Album)” by The Screaming Pope is available on almost all streaming sites for streaming and Download on Friday, September 15th
“Honey Bunny (the Hip-Hop Album)” is a unique departure from the usual Techno/Electronica albums by The Screaming Pope
The previous Screaming Pope album, “The Era Of Possibilities” was called “A Masterpiece” by one fan
“Honey Bunny (the Hip-Hop Album)” by The Screaming Pope is a combination of Hip-Hop, Rap, Trap, Reggae, and Go-Go music

ABOUT
The Screaming Pope is Techno Music Veteran George Bolton. He is a Music Video Producer, Engineer, Session Musician, Visual Artist, Songwriter, and Electronic Music Composer from the Boston area
